NTPC Concludes Vigilance Awareness Week 2025 With Nationwide Outreach, Reaffirms Ethical Governance And Clean Energy Commitment

WhatsApp
Copy link
URL has been copied successfully!

New Delhi: NTPC Limited, India’s largest integrated power utility, successfully concluded Vigilance Awareness Week 2025 with a robust lineup of activities and outreach initiatives across its offices, projects, and regional headquarters. The observance reaffirmed NTPC’s unwavering commitment to integrity, transparency, and ethical governance.

This year’s theme, “Vigilance: Our Shared Responsibility,” was part of a broader three-month Vigilance Awareness Campaign that began on August 18, 2025. The formal commencement of the week was marked by CMD Gurdeep Singh administering the Integrity Pledge to employees on October 27, joined by Directors, senior officials, and teams from across NTPC’s nationwide operations.

Throughout the week, NTPC locations hosted walkathons, pledge ceremonies, competitions, awareness sessions, and workshops. Several sites extended the message beyond corporate boundaries through community outreach and public awareness drives, reinforcing vigilance as a collective responsibility.

As the week concluded, employees across NTPC reaffirmed their dedication to the company’s core values of integrity and transparency.

NTPC currently contributes one-fourth of India’s power requirements, with an installed capacity of 84,849 MW. An additional 30.90 GW is under construction, including 13.3 GW of renewable energy capacity. The company aims to achieve 60 GW of renewable energy capacity by 2032, supporting India’s Net Zero ambitions.

With a diversified portfolio spanning thermal, hydro, solar, and wind power, NTPC remains committed to delivering reliable, affordable, and sustainable electricity. The organization continues to adopt best practices, foster innovation, and embrace clean energy technologies to drive a greener future.

Beyond power generation, NTPC is expanding into new business areas such as e-mobility, battery storage, pumped hydro storage, waste-to-energy, nuclear power, and green hydrogen solutions. It has also participated in competitive bidding for power distribution in Union Territories, furthering its role in India’s energy transformation.
